Description
IC XDCP 16-TAP 10K CMOS 8-SOIC
Manufacturer
Intersil
Series
XDCP™r
Datasheet

Specifications of X9116WS8IZ

Taps
16
Resistance (ohms)
10K
Number Of Circuits
1
Temperature Coefficient
300 ppm/°C Typical
Memory Type
Non-Volatile
Interface
Up/Down (3-Wire)
Voltage - Supply
4.5 V ~ 5.5 V
Operating Temperature
-40°C ~ 85°C
Mounting Type
Surface Mount
Package / Case
8-SOIC (3.9mm Width)
Resistance In Ohms
10K
Lead Free Status / RoHS Status
Lead free / RoHS Compliant
